I am trying to upgrade our Netweaver (Java only) stack from 7.0 to 7.3
using SUM. The kernel patch level is at 179. We have several Netweaver
instances running on one server (3 PI instances, and 3 EP instances).
I'm starting with our development enterprise portal server, and an error
occurs during the second step of "Specify Credentials". I correctly
supply the <sid>adm user name and password.
Afterwards, another screen,appears with a message stating the user
credentials for the listed instances do not match. After verifying that
the two match, I click the "Next" button, and the following screen is shown.
I did notice before clicking the "Next" button that the instance numbers
listed ( 1 and 0 - don't know that this matters) were not the instance
numbers to our development enterprise portal, but actually the instance
numbers to our Quality enterprise portal. The instances to our
development EP are 8 and 9.
These instances, as mentioned before, are on the same server.

Hi Terry,
Could you please check the following SAP notes -
1563660 "OS user password does not work, please reenter" or "FAIL:
Invalid Credentials" during EHPI / Upgrade
1565645 SAP composite note: sapcontrol
Please make sure that you have only the necessary profiles in the
profile directory and remove the unnecessary files.
Once you do all the changes, please restart the sapstartsrv service.
Also, check the permissions of the files in the kernel directory.
